What people use each for
The jobs each tool is most often brought in to do.
NextRequest
- Receiving and routing public records and FOIA requestsnot Rock Solid
- Tracking request status and statutory deadlines centrallynot Rock Solid
- Redacting documents before release with RapidReviewnot Rock Solid
- Invoicing and collecting payment for records requestsnot Rock Solid
- Publishing a public-facing request portal for residentsnot Rock Solid

Where each one falls short
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.
NextRequest
- Now sold as part of the CivicPlus product line rather than standalone, and nextrequest.com redirects into the CivicPlus site
- Pricing is not published
- Aimed at government agencies, so it is not a general purpose request or ticketing tool
